Summary: The collection consists of manuscript materials, sound recordings, photographs, and moving images documenting the performance of Peking Opera, Swiss folk music, bluegrass music, Bulgarian folk music, Javanese gamelan music and dance, and gospel music recorded live outdoors on Neptune Plaza in front of the Library of Congress.
Contents: April 18: Han Sheng Chinese Opera Institute (China) -- May 16: The Alder Family, Switzerland (Swiss traditional music) -- June 20: Seldom Scene (Bluegrass) -- July 18: Bulgari (Bulgarian) -- August 15: Ensemble of the Embassy of the Republic of Indonesia (Javanese gamelan) -- September 19: Prophecy: Cops for Christ (Gospel)
